Qualifications for getting a Wells Fargo home improvement loan

Wells Fargo requires you to qualify for a loan before getting it. You can obtain a Home improvement loan from $3,000 to $100,000 with no origination fee. You can use your loan for projects such as home repairs, HVAC replacement, kitchen remodeling, and home renovations.

Before applying for your home improvement loan, you must be a Wells Fargo customer. The loan requires a minimum credit score of 660. That is a fair credit score. Loan terms vary from 1-3 years for loans under $5,000. Large amounts can have loan terms of up to 84 months.

Application Process For Wells Fargo Home Improvement Loan

You can apply for your loan online. One can begin by visiting the Wells Fargo Loan application page and then indicate whether you are a Wells Fargo customer or not. If you are not a customer, you must open an account and proceed to apply for your loan. You can find a location to open your account.

You must select one way to log into your account if you have an account with the bank. You can sign in with your Wells Fargo username and password so that Wells Fargo can fill in some of your personal details. You can also manually enter your details to sign in to your account. Once you are ready, you can sign in to your account.

Facts About Wells Fargo Home Improvement Loans

The home improvement loan from Wells Fargo allows you to complete your home renovation projects with a flexible interest rate personal loan. The company offers a loan term option that lets you pick the loan option that’s right for you. Facts about the Wells Fargo loan include;

  1. Fixed interest rates. The loans offer a fixed term, competitive fixed rate, and fixed monthly payment.
  2. Flexible financing options. You can choose your preferred loan amount and repayment term.
  3. No collateral is needed. You will not be limited by the amount of equity in your home. Therefore, you can borrow money without using your home as collateral.

Wells Fargo Home Projects Card

Other than the home improvement loan, you can opt for the Home Projects card, which offers a revolving line of credit for your home improvement projects. These include getting a new boiler, furnace, or air conditioning system. You can use the card with various companies to purchase the necessary materials.

Most importantly, you can grow your credit scores using your card. Again, the card is revolving; thus, you can borrow money again when needed.

Wells Fargo home improvement loan rates

The rates are flexible since you get fixed rates as low as 5.99% APR. Fixed rates allow you to pay the same amount all through. That protects you from paying high amounts in the case of variable APRs.

You can save yourself from high-interest loans by building your credit scores. Higher scores attract low-interest rates. That is because financial companies see you as a low-risk borrower.

What you should know before applying for the Home Improvement credit card

Before applying for the card, you must know that you need fair credit or better. That means you should have a score of 640 to get approved. It is also crucial for you to understand that the card is mainly for home improvement products and services. You can use the card at businesses that sell home improvement projects.

How much would a $8,000 loan cost per month?

The monthly payment on an $8,000 loan ranges from $109 to $804, depending on the APR and how long the loan lasts. For example, if you take out an $8,000 loan for one year with an APR of 36%, your monthly payment will be $804.
